Abstract
A METHOD OF DRILLING A WELLBORE (12) CAN INCLUDE DRILLING THE WELLBORE WITH A CONTINUOUS TUBING DRILL STRING (16), AND SENSING AT LEAST ONE PARAMETER WITH AN OPTICAL WAVEGUIDE (88) IN THE DRILL STRING. A WELL SYSTEM CAN INCLUDE A CONTINUOUS TUBING DRILL STRING, AND AN OPTICAL WAVEGUIDE IN THE DRILL STRING. THE OPTICAL WAVEGUIDE MAY SENSE AT LEAST ONE PARAMETER DISTRIBUTED ALONG THE DRILL STRING.
